Gave up at 58%
At the moment there are 9 reviews for this book and 4 of the 8 five star ones are single review accounts, mostly labelled "Amazon Customer". I know friends / family want to be encouraging but it can have a negative effect as the surperlatives often promise more than is delivered. I don't like doing down a fledgling author - but I'm afraid that I'm not enjoying this.The chapters alternate around a number of characters and sometimes they repeat the scene from the previous chapter, sometimes they pick up immediately afterwards. It's a good idea and there are flickers of a good writer in there - the only problem is that I'm bored.I've got to 58% and I'm giving up - mainly because I don't really LIKE any of the characters, so I've nothing invested in the outcome. They are either 1 dimensional bit parters (who drop in and out) or slightly psycho (the main male character, Giles) or just annoying (the main female characters, Lucy and Paula). The latter pair are annoying because they often say the same things at the same time. Not only have I never known friends do that - it gets wearing after you've read it a few times.I kind of want to know what the twist at the end is - but I've just paged through a LOT of text for the sex scenes and also all the stuff at the race track - and I just can't take any more. I've just read Paula mentally putting a black mark against someone for wearing black jean. Sorry but that kind of thinking is too shallow for me. Time to delete.
